The Role of Generative AI in Pharma UX
Generative AI refers to systems that create content—text, images, prototypes or even code—based on patterns learned from large datasets. In the pharmaceutical space, this capability unlocks:
- Rapid prototyping: AI can spin up realistic UI mockups, saving weeks of manual design.
- Personalised content: Tailored training modules for doctors, nurses or patients.
- Adaptive communications: AI-generated notifications that speak in the recipient’s language.
These applications combine to form an AI-Driven User Experience that is:
- Agile: Designs evolve dynamically as user feedback streams in.
- User-centric: Stakeholder needs shape every interaction.
- Data-powered: Real-time insights from multiple sources guide decision-making.
Key Challenges in Pharmaceutical UX and Adoption
Despite the promise of digital tools, pharma faces unique barriers:
- Regulatory compliance: Every UI element must meet legal and privacy standards.
- Data overload: Clinicians juggle patient charts, literature databases and launch collateral.
- Trust and clarity: Complex drug data demands crystal-clear presentation.
Traditional UX flows often fall short:
- Lengthy tutorials that no one reads.
- Static dashboards packed with charts, not insights.
- One-size-fits-all content that fails to engage niche audiences.
Addressing these gaps requires more than good design. It demands an AI-Driven User Experience that learns, adapts and personalises at scale.

Practical Steps to Implement Generative AI in Pharma UX
Ready to get started? Here’s a simple roadmap:
-
Audit your current UX landscape
Map out every touchpoint: portal logins, mobile apps, onboarding emails. Note friction points. -
Define user personas clearly
Segment by role (e.g., oncologist, GP, patient) and by need (e.g., drug safety info, dosing calculators). -
Select generative AI tools
Choose platforms that support text, image and prototyping generation. Ensure they comply with pharma regulations. -
Integrate predictive analytics
Embed Smart Launch’s real-time monitoring into your dashboards. Start capturing engagement signals from day one. -
Implement human-in-the-loop
Combine AI suggestions with expert review—especially for regulatory content. -
Test and iterate
Run A/B tests on messaging, visuals and workflows. Let AI surface the winners. -
Monitor compliance and security
Maintain audit trails for every AI-generated asset. Ensure data privacy across regions.

Best Practices for Designing AI-Driven UX in Pharma
To make your AI-Driven User Experience successful, keep these pointers in mind:
- Prioritise transparency: Explain when and how AI is making recommendations.
- Ensure data quality: Garbage in, garbage out. Use verified, up-to-date datasets.
- Maintain a human touch: Let experts review AI-generated content before release.
- Embed compliance checks: Automate regulatory reviews within your workflow.
- Encourage feedback loops: Prompt users to share what works and what doesn’t.
By following these best practices, you’ll mitigate risks and amplify engagement.
